Aerodynamic Resistance and Sail Effect

The tread pattern of the Continental AERO 111 focuses on optimizing the aerodynamic properties of the tire/wheel combination, even at low rim heights. 48 small air clamps have been distributed over the entire surface of the tire. The task of these so-called "vortex generators" is to direct the turbulence on the surface of the front wheel - to create the "perfected storm", so to speak, which reduces the air resistance of the entire wheel-tire unit.

Wheel-tire System without AERO 111 with Higher Aerodynamic Resistance

  • The lower the rim profile, the less the rider benefits from the forward force ("sail effect"), as the airflow at the rim breaks off early and causes turbulence - with the result that the air resistance increases. The rim has the same effect on the system as the mast and sail have on a sailing boat.
  • "Sailing effect" very small and only present with higher rim profiles
  • Stall with turbulent wake 

Wheel-tire System with AERO 111 with Reduced Aerodynamic Resistance

  • The "sailing effect" increases. Even with lower rim profiles, the rider benefits from this effect because the laminar airflow reduces air resistance.
  • Increased forward force ("sail effect")
  • "Vortex generators" in the tire tread ensure a laminar (adjacent) air flow, which reduces the air resistance of the wheel-tire system

Vectran Breaker
Vectran is spun from Vectra, a liquid crystalline polymer. The result is a thermoplastic multifilament yarn that is more cut-resistant than aramid and has five times the tensile strength of steel. 
The Vectran Breaker is lighter, more flexible and offers better protection against punctures than a comparable nylon puncture protection and does not have a negative impact on rolling resistance.
